The Technical Barriers to Trade (TBT) Agreement

Abstract:
This chapter examines the WTO's Technical Barriers to Trade (TBT) Agreement, which seeks to prevent technical regulations, standards and conformity assessment procedures from creating unnecessary barriers to international trade. Though covering all goods, it has significant implications for food regulation, particularly in labelling, packaging and safety requirements. The TBT Agreement balances trade liberalization with national sovereignty, allowing member states to implement regulations to protect legitimate objectives like health, safety and environmental protection. The chapter highlights key principles, including the necessity and proportionality of technical measures, the alignment with international standards whenever feasible and procedural guarantees like transparency and stakeholder engagement. The interplay between the TBT and the WTO's Sanitary and Phytosanitary (SPS) Agreement is also explored, showing how the SPS governs health-related measures while the TBT applies to non-health-related technical barriers. The chapter concludes by emphasizing the TBT Agreement's role in fostering harmonized global trade while respecting members’ regulatory objectives.
